Last Updated at 11 October 2024NPS PASWAN TOALA LAGMA: A Rural Primary School in Bihar, India
NPS PASWAN TOALA LAGMA is a primary school located in the rural SONBARSA block of SAHARSA district, Bihar, India. Established in 2007, this co-educational institution is managed by the Department of Education and caters to students from Class 1 to Class 5. The school's instruction medium is Hindi, reflecting the local language. Currently, the school building is under construction, but it already possesses three classrooms in good condition, ensuring a conducive learning environment for its students.
Infrastructure and Amenities:
The school's infrastructure is developing. While the building is still under construction, it boasts three functional classrooms. Two boys' toilets and two girls' toilets are available, providing essential sanitation facilities. Hand pumps supply drinking water, meeting the students' hydration needs. Importantly, ramps for disabled children ensure accessibility to classrooms. The absence of a boundary wall is noted, suggesting a need for future improvement in this area. The school is connected to the electricity grid, supporting its educational operations.
Staff and Teaching Resources:
The school has a dedicated teaching staff comprising two male teachers and one female teacher. The school provides midday meals, prepared and served on the premises, which contribute significantly to the students' well-being and learning.
